⢠Secure sockets
â Protocol versions: SSL v3/TLS 1.0/TLS 1.1/TLS 1.2
â On-chip powerful crypto engine for fast, secure Wi-Fi and internet connections with 256-bit AES
encryption for TLS and SSL connections
â Ciphers suites

â Server authentication
â Client authentication
â Domain name verification
â Socket upgrade to secure socket â STARTTLS
⢠Secure HTTP server (HTTPS)
⢠The trusted root-certificate catalog verifies that the CA used by the application is trusted and known
secure content delivery.
⢠The TI root-of-trust public key is a hardware-based mechanism that allows authenticating TI as the
genuine origin of a given content using asymmetric keys.
⢠Secure content delivery allows file transfer to the system in a secure way on any unsecured tunnel.
⢠Code and data security
â Secured network information: Network passwords and certificates are encrypted
â Secured and authenticated service pack: SP is signed based on TI certificate
6.2.3 Host Interface and Driver
⢠Interfaces over a 4-wire SPI with any MCU or a processor at a clock speed of 20 MHz
⢠Interfaces over UART with any MCU with a baud rate up to 3 Mbps. A low footprint driver is provided
for TI MCUs and is easily ported to any processor or ASIC.
⢠Simple APIs enable easy integration with any single-threaded or multithreaded application.
